1. 5G Connectivity: A New Era of Speed and Efficiency
We’re stepping into a new digital era, and at its core is 5G connectivity.
Imagine downloading your favorite movie in seconds or enjoying lag-free gaming, even in crowded spaces.
That’s the power of 5G! It’s not just about speed—5G allows more devices to connect simultaneously without slowing down.
For the next billion smartphone users, this will open doors to smart cities, immersive IoT experiences, and seamless remote work. Whether you’re monitoring your smart home, joining a virtual conference, or using apps for daily tasks, 5G will make everything smoother and faster. Think of it as the backbone of the digital revolution, enabling technologies we’re only beginning to imagine.
2. Affordable AI and Machine Learning: Smarter Devices for Everyone
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ning (ML) are no longer just fancy features on expensive devices. As these technologies become affordable, everyone can enjoy smarter, more intuitive smartphones. Voice assistants like Siri or Google Assistant will become more accurate and helpful, predictive text will understand your habits better, and camera enhancements will turn everyday photos into stunning masterpieces.
What’s even cooler?
AI will improve battery life, device security, and personalization. Your smartphone will adapt to your unique lifestyle—whether that means learning your morning routine, predicting the apps you’ll use next, or keeping your sensitive data safe. This kind of “personal touch” will empower billions to learn, work, and connect in ways that once seemed impossible.

4. Battery Tech: Charging Forward
Ah, the dreaded low-battery notification! Fortunately, battery technology is evolving to tackle this universal frustration. New innovations like graphene batteries and solar charging are promising not only faster charging speeds but also longer-lasting power.
For users in regions with unreliable power access, solar-powered smartphones could be life-changing. These devices could charge directly from the sun, empowering individuals to stay connected in remote or off-grid areas. No matter where you are, smarter battery solutions will ensure your smartphone keeps up with your day.

7. Global Payment Systems and Financial Inclusion
For millions of people worldwide, smartphones are becoming their first connection to financial services. With built-in features like mobile wallets, digital payments, and even cryptocurrencies, smartphones are transforming how people manage money. Cross-border transactions are becoming easier, faster, and more affordable—no need for a traditional bank!
In emerging markets, this is especially revolutionary. The next billion users will gain access to tools that allow them to save, invest, and grow their businesses, paving the way for economic empowerment and financial inclusion. Smartphones are not just communication devices—they’re gateways to economic opportunity.
8. Privacy and Security: Keeping Data Safe
With billions of users joining the digital world, privacy and security have never been more critical. Smartphones are evolving to include stronger encryption, biometric authentication like facial recognition, and privacy-focused software to keep sensitive information safe.
Technologies like blockchain and decentralized systems are also on the rise, giving users more control over their personal data. This means greater transparency and stronger protections against hackers and cyber threats. For the next billion users, a smartphone won’t just be a tool for connection—it’ll be a trusted companion in keeping their digital lives secure.
